The Netcat utility program supports a wide range of commands to manage networks and monitor the flow of traffic data between systems. Think of it as a free and easy companion tool to use alongside Wireshark, which specializes in the analysis of network packets. The original version of Netcat was released back in and has received a number of iterative updates in the decades since. Netcat can be a useful tool for any IT team, though the growth of internally managed network services and cloud computing make that particular environment a natural fit.
Network and system administrators need to be able to quickly identify how their network is performing and what type of activity is occurring. Netcat functions as a back-end tool that allows for port scanning and port listening. In addition, you can actually transfer files directly through Netcat or use it as a backdoor into other networked systems. Partnered with a tool like Varonis Edge, you would receive an alert of any unusual activity and could then use Netcat to investigate.
Lastly, Netcat is a flexible tool because of how it can be scripted for larger tasks. Once you have a Netcat application set up on your Windows or Linux server, you can start running basic commands to test its functionality.

When trying to diagnose a network issue or performance problem, executing a port scan with Netcat is a smart first step to take. The scan will check the status of all ports on the given domain or IP address so that you can determine whether a firewall or other blocking mechanism is in place.
Note that the numbers at the end of the command tell Netcat to only scan for ports between numbers 1 and You should always perform port scans when connected to your local enterprise network.

Netcat is a flexible tool and you can use it to perform banner grabbing. What is banner grabbing? Banner grabbing is the process of identifying software name and version of the service running on specific ports. Use netcat in client mode to perform http banner grabbing like shown in Figure 8. Networking are. Netcat is a very useful Unix command we use to perform various networking tasks, and it's very useful to debug and also learn how things work.
It's available through the nc command. Connect to any network server using this syntax: nc DOMAIN PORT nc localhost Once it's connected to the server, you can send any message by typing them, and you will see any reply sent back by the server You need netcat on both the computer receiving the file and the one sending it.
On Debian-based distributions such as Ubuntu or Linux Mint, install the utility with: sudo apt install netcat-openbsd. While there are windows ports of netcat available, none of them includes the features which the OpenBSD version of netcat provides.
I used the FreeBSD version, applied some patches of the debian port of this version and fixed a couple of patch rejects and incompatibilities.
